I’m sure that hard-working member will agree with me when I say that we don’t always see eye to eye with the NDP and the Green Party over there, but I was glad to hear over the weekend that the NDP and Green Party agree that long-term-care homes are indeed homes.

Well, Speaker, that just leaves one party in this Legislature that doesn’t seem to get that picture. And I guess it’s no surprise, right? The Liberals, when they were in power for the better part of two decades, made a goal. They said they were going to build 35,000 long-term-care spaces, an admirable goal; I think that was in 2007. But do you know what happened when they exited government in 2018? They had built a net new 611. So it’s no wonder, I suppose, that the Liberals don’t want to consider these homes homes, because they failed miserably to actually build them.

This Premier is getting it done with a record investment in capital and the health human—

Speaking of behavioural specialized units—a $5.5-million investment announced just recently for three BSUs in homes in Brampton, Timmins and Etobicoke.

This is the game-changing investment that we need for our seniors. It’s not just about capital, which we are investing to record levels; it’s not just about health human resources, which we are investing to record levels—it is about targeted approaches to making sure our seniors get the right care in the right place.

Let’s contrast that. We talked about the past record of the Liberal government. Today, they have a leader in Bonnie Crombie, somebody who promises to build but fails to deliver and doesn’t even consider a long-term-care home a home for its residents.

I challenge the Leader of the Liberal Party and every single one of those Liberal members to walk with me into their ridings, into those homes and tell those hard-working seniors who built our communities, who gave us our lives as we know it, that they are not living in a home. This government disagrees. We’re going to continue to invest into those who took care of us—
